MySQL更新评能指南

资源类型:00-9.net 2025-07-18 06:57

mysql update comment简介:



MySQL UPDATE Comment:提升数据维护效率与可读性的关键实践 在当今数据驱动的时代,数据库管理系统(DBMS)作为数据存储与处理的基石,其重要性不言而喻

    MySQL,作为最流行的开源关系型数据库管理系统之一,广泛应用于各类Web应用、数据仓库及企业解决方案中

    在MySQL的日常运维与开发过程中,数据的更新(UPDATE)操作是极为频繁且关键的一环

    然而,仅仅执行UPDATE语句往往不足以满足高效、可维护的数据管理需求

    这时,“UPDATE comment”就显得尤为重要,它不仅能够提升数据维护的效率,还能显著增强代码的可读性与团队协作的顺畅度

    本文将从多个维度深入探讨MySQL UPDATE comment的应用价值、实现方法以及最佳实践,旨在帮助数据库管理员(DBA)与开发人员更好地利用这一功能

     一、MySQL UPDATE Comment的基础认知 在MySQL中,comment通常用于为表、列或索引添加描述性文字,便于后续维护者理解其用途或业务逻辑

    尽管标准的UPDATE语句本身并不直接支持在语句内部添加comment,但我们可以通过几种变通方法实现类似效果,比如使用`- / ... /`风格的注释来嵌入额外信息,或是在表结构层面为相关字段添加comment,间接增强UPDATE操作的可读性和意图表达

     1.1 直接在UPDATE语句中添加注释 虽然MySQL官方文档并未将注释视为UPDATE语句的正式部分,但在SQL代码中嵌入注释是一种广泛接受的实践

    例如: sql UPDATE users SET email = newemail@example.com WHERE user_id =123; - / Update users email due to security policy change/ 这里的注释说明了更新操作的原因,对于后续的代码审查或问题排查极为有用

     1.2 利用表/列级comment增强上下文理解 在表或列定义时添加comment,可以为UPDATE操作提供必要的背景信息

    例如: sql CREATE TABLE users( user_id INT PRIMARY KEY COMMENT Unique identifier for each user, email VARCHAR(255) NOT NULL COMMENT Users contact email, must be unique ); 当执行UPDATE email操作时,了解email字段的具体含义和业务规则变得直观易懂

     二、UPDATE Comment的价值体现 2.1 提升代码可读性 清晰、准确的comment能够极大地提升SQL代码的可读性

    对于复杂的UPDATE操作,尤其是涉及多表关联、条件逻辑复杂的场景,通过注释说明更新的目的、依据或潜在影响,可以显著减少阅读和理解代码的时间成本

     2.2 促进团队协作 在团队协作环境中,代码的可读性和自解释性至关重要

    UPDATE comment使得新加入的成员能够更快地熟悉代码逻辑,减少因误解或遗漏信息导致的错误

    同时,它也为代码审查提供了便利,审查者可以迅速把握更新操作的意图和潜在风险

     2.3便于问题追踪与审计 在数据库发生异常或需要数据恢复时,UPDATE comment能够成为追踪问题根源的重要线索

    它记录了操作的历史背景,有助于快速定位是哪个更新导致了数据状态的变化

    此外,对于满足合规性和审计要求的应用场景,保留操作的注释信息也是必不可少的

     2.4 支持自动化与文档生成 许多数据库管理工具和框架支持从数据库元数据(包括注释)自动生成文档或脚本

    UPDATE comment作为元数据的一部分,可以自动整合到这些文档中,使得数据模型和业务逻辑更加透明,便于培训和知识传承

     三、实现UPDATE Comment的最佳实践 3.1遵循一致的注释风格 团队内部应建立并遵循统一的注释风格指南,包括注释的位置(语句前后)、格式(单行/多行)、内容结构(操作目的、条件说明、影响范围等)

    这不仅提升了代码的整体美观性,也便于团队成员间的沟通与协作

     3.2简洁明了,避免冗余 注释应简洁明了,直接点明要点,避免冗长或模棱两可的描述

    好的注释应能迅速传达关键信息,而不是成为额外的阅读负担

     3.3 更新操作与注释同步维护 当UPDATE语句的逻辑发生变化时,务必同步更新相关的注释信息,确保注释与实际操作保持一致

    过时的注释会误导后续开发者,增加维护难度

     3.4 利用版本控制系统记录变更历史 将SQL脚本(包括注释)纳入版本控制系统,可以追踪每一次更新操作及其注释的变更历史

    这不仅有助于回溯问题,还能为团队提供学习成长的宝贵资源

     3.5 结合业务逻辑,提供上下文 注释不仅要说明“做了什么”,更要解释“为什么这么做”

    结合具体的业务逻辑或用户需求,提供足够的上下文信息,有助于维护者更全面地理解更新操作的意义和影响

     3.6 考虑使用外部文档系统 对于特别复杂或频繁的UPDATE操作,可以考虑在外部文档系统中详细记录,同时在SQL代码中通过简短的注释指向这些文档

    这样做既能保持代码的简洁性,又能提供详尽的参考资料

     四、案例分析:UPDATE Comment的实际应用 假设我们正在维护一个电商平台的用户积分系统,需要定期根据用户的购买行为调整其积分余额

    以下是一个包含注释的UPDATE操作示例: sql -- Adjust users points based on purchase history for Q3 promotions UPDATE users u JOIN orders o ON u.user_id = o.user_id JOIN products p ON o.product_id = p.product_id SET u.points = u.points +(o.amount - p.points_per_dollar 1.5) -- Multiply by1.5 for Q3 bonus WHERE o.order_date BETWEEN 2023-07-01 AND 2023-09-30 AND p.category_id IN(1,2,3); -- Only applicable to electronics, fashion, and home goods categories 此示例中,注释详细说明了更新的目的(基于Q3促销活动调整积分)、条件(订单日期、产品类别)以及具体的计算逻辑(积分倍数)

    这样的注释大大增强了代码的可读性和可维护性

     五、结语 MySQL UPDATE comment虽非SQL标准的一部分,但通过灵活运用注释和表/列级comment,我们完全能够实现类似功能,显著提升数据维

阅读全文
上一篇:Aide教程:轻松上手使用MySQL数据库

最新收录:

  • MySQL表双主键设计揭秘
  • Aide教程:轻松上手使用MySQL数据库
  • MySQL查询技巧:如何处理BETWEEN与NULL值的陷阱
  • MySQL技巧:轻松屏蔽查询中的重复行
  • MySQL5.0数据库下载指南
  • MySQL技巧:动态生成列头指南
  • 从备份服务器恢复MySQL数据库:全面指南
  • MySQL表中添加字段的实用指南
  • MySQL最大连接数上限详解
  • MySQL高效过滤大量ID技巧
  • RedHat7环境下MySQL数据库搭建与配置指南
  • MySQL中多个条件判断技巧解析
  • 首页 | mysql update comment:MySQL更新评能指南